Tiny Tots

The objective of the Tiny Tots program is two-fold:  to create an awareness & appreciation of music in pre-school aged children and to introduce them to classical music and the instruments of the orchestra.  The Tiny Tots program provides an age appropriate format that is educational and fun.  Through a combination of an educational packet and classroom visits, students develop an awareness of classical music, orchestral instruments, how the instruments work and general music knowledge. Primary leaning concepts of the pre-school years, such as colors, numbers, shapes and letter recognition are also tied into the presentation.

The Tiny Tots program takes place over five consecutive weeks. Our education coordinator and a musician team up each week for these visits.  The first four programs introduce children to the specific instrument families of the orchestra – Strings, Woodwinds, Brass, and Percussion.  The fifth and final program reintroduces the individual instrument families, and, through ensemble performances, demonstrates how these families work together as a group.

All visits are structured to include vocabulary, music, movement and an opportunity for hands on activities with the instruments.  An Educational Packet is provided to each pre-school for the preparation of the children in advance of each visit.  The packet also works well for reinforcement of concept taught during the visits.   The packet includes:  an overview of each visit, reproducible coloring sheets featuring instruments in the orchestra, an activity page for each instrument featured in the visit, as well as suggested activities, music vocabulary, CDs with listening guide, and additional suggested resources.
